We don't play in a "diamond" though with a stereotypically set "DM" and "10", that's not really our scheme. For months, since September at least we've been playing in a general 424 which in some games looks like 4231, 433, (like yesterday) or what have you depending on different moments and player movements. If anything we've been characterized more by having a double pivot this season with Bellingham and Valverde covering and moving and interchanging any which way on the sides.
What I'm not liking is the sense of not having a sense of conventional proportionality with the attackers and width on both sides with a set target upfront and what that implies for the midfielders and fullbacks and how we attack and defend. It's not as well-rounded of a thing as it could be what we have.
I would think in a fluid front two partnership between Vinicius and Mbappe that it would be Mbappe who would be more adept at being serviced. Even if we get Mbappe I feel we would benefit from having a very good striker who could swallow being a super sub (ala 11/12-12/13 Higuain) who we could use if we had to be more flexible in a CL/big game tie, and it's a shame Vinicius hasn't shown any dispositions as a set right sided forward. In the league Mbappe-Vinicius would be enough.

Won't work because you'll burn Bellingham out. Also, he can't recover against truly world-class players. And Vini does not play defense (in the sense that he's like a traffic cone even when he does get back). Rodrygo does.
442 has been retired mostly for a reason. it was eaten alive by a 4231 (which destroys a 442). Mourinho was beating everyone when the 442 was prevalent for a reason. Once teams went to a 433, he lost his tactical advantage. However, a counter-attacking 442 can beat a 433... but i don't think Real Madrdi want to be a counter-attacking team.
It's also near impossible to press out of a 442 effectively.

Not in guaranteed wages... but image rights are extremely valuable. For example, CR7 made about 2x his wages in image rights revenue.
The signing bonus is the big equalizer. 150 million let's call it. If you amortize that over 5 years (contract length) and it's another 30 million per season. That usually goes to the club you transfer from. So in essence, he's making roughly 65 million a year.

Fred Hermel came on RMC... said that Madrid "feel very confident" of Mbappe signing. But before they say anything, they're waiting for Mbappe to tell PSG and to make the public announcement.
Big thing is that Hermel said that Mbappe will play inside forward from the left side. Carlo is not expected to change formations... 442. So one of Vini or Rodrygo will be sacrificed and will play inside forward from the right. To note that it doesn't really mean much in a 442. They will roam all over the pitch and change sides depending on the flow anyhow. It's more rigid with 3 strikers. With Bellingham pushing forward, it will be fine.
RM feel that it's more important to keep all their young midfielders happy (Jude, Tchou, Cama and Valverde) while building the entire scheme around Mbappe on the attack and Jude in the midfield. Other big news is that RM is looking for an anchor in central defense... with Ibrahima Konate as the target this summer.
I also don't feel that Carlo is that rigid anymore. If a 433 is better, so it will be. But the current squad works with a 442. Mbappe and Vini are also not that rigid... they will get a feel for each other and, IMO, will find out the best dynamic between the two of them. They're both very mobile. Rodrygo is that big question mark IMO. 3 strikers is more rigid as I explained and you'd sacrifice a midfielder. You can't have everything of course. You bring in Mbappe and someone will need to leave the starting lineup and the attacking dynamic of course changes.
